From cabf6cf613ca0a79ecc2a8204f9d2ac164d65ee8 Mon Sep 17 00:00:00 2001 From: MiaoWoo Date: Tue, 27 Aug 2019 16:35:27 +0800 Subject: [PATCH] eslint: fix lint error --- packages/vscode/package.json | 6 +++--- packages/vscode/src/extension.ts | 8 +++++--- packages/vscode/src/provider/faas.ts | 14 +++++++------- 3 files changed, 15 insertions(+), 13 deletions(-) diff --git a/packages/vscode/package.json b/packages/vscode/package.json index 411af23..1bd7017 100644 --- a/packages/vscode/package.json +++ b/packages/vscode/package.json @@ -11,7 +11,7 @@ "Other" ], "activationEvents": [ - "onCommand:extension.helloWorld" + "*" ], "main": "./dist/extension.js", "contributes": { @@ -60,8 +60,8 @@ "vscode:prepublish": "yarn run compile", "compile": "tsc -p ./", "watch": "tsc -watch -p ./", - "postinstall": "node ../../node_modules/vscode/bin/install", - "test": "yarn run compile && node ./node_modules/vscode/bin/test" + "postinstall": "node ../../../node_modules/vscode/bin/install", + "test": "yarn run compile && node ../../../node_modules/vscode/bin/test" }, "dependencies": { "@dayu/docker-api": "^0.0.1", diff --git a/packages/vscode/src/extension.ts b/packages/vscode/src/extension.ts index 6d73a13..bc9c0e6 100644 --- a/packages/vscode/src/extension.ts +++ b/packages/vscode/src/extension.ts @@ -1,14 +1,16 @@ // The module 'vscode' contains the VS Code extensibility API // Import the module and reference it with the alias vscode in your code below import * as vscode from 'vscode'; -process.env.DOCKER_HOST = '/var/run/docker.sock' -import { OpenFaasProvider, DockerProvider } from './provider' +process.env.DOCKER_HOST = 'https://dscli.miaowoo.cc'; +import { OpenFaasProvider, DockerProvider } from './provider'; // this method is called when your extension is activated // your extension is activated the very first time the command is executed export function activate(context: vscode.ExtensionContext) { - console.log('init...') + console.log('init...'); + // tslint:disable-next-line: no-unused-expression new DockerProvider(context); + // tslint:disable-next-line: no-unused-expression new OpenFaasProvider(context); } diff --git a/packages/vscode/src/provider/faas.ts b/packages/vscode/src/provider/faas.ts index 784a24e..5657124 100644 --- a/packages/vscode/src/provider/faas.ts +++ b/packages/vscode/src/provider/faas.ts @@ -1,6 +1,6 @@ -import * as vscode from 'vscode' -import * as faas from '@dayu/faas' -import { BaseProvider, ItemContextValue } from './base' +import * as vscode from 'vscode'; +import * as faas from '@dayu/faas'; +import { BaseProvider, ItemContextValue } from './base'; enum Type { ROOT = "ROOT", @@ -10,10 +10,10 @@ export class OpenFaasProvider extends BaseProvider { onDidChangeTreeData?: vscode.Event; constructor(context: vscode.ExtensionContext) { - super() + super(); context.subscriptions.push( vscode.window.registerTreeDataProvider('openfaas-explorer', this) - ) + ); } getTreeItem(element: vscode.TreeItem): vscode.TreeItem | Promise { @@ -29,7 +29,7 @@ export class OpenFaasProvider extends BaseProvider { type: Type.ROOT }, icon: "logo" - })] + })]; } let value: ItemContextValue = JSON.parse(element.contextValue); switch (value.type) { @@ -39,7 +39,7 @@ export class OpenFaasProvider extends BaseProvider { return this.createTreeItem({ label: f.name, tooltip: JSON.stringify(f, undefined, 2) - }) + }); }); default: return [];